Samsung releases A3 machines in Jordan

Jul 21, 2014

The OEM launched its MultiXpress series in the Middle Eastern nation.

Samsung's MultiXpress K2200

Samsung’s MultiXpress K2200

MENAFN reported on the launch by Samsung’s subsidiary, Samsung Electronics Levant, of the MultiXpress A3 laser range in Jordan. The printers will be sold by official distributor The National Office System Co., and are aimed at enterprises as well as private, public and banking sectors.

The launch was held at the Intercontinental Jordan Hotel at a seminar for customers from the different market sectors, with a workshop also held by The National Office System to demonstrate the printers. The devices include the K2200 and K2200ND, which are MFPs featuring “high quality printing output”, a 1200 x 1200 dpi resolution, high-capacity toner cartridges and RECP technology, which “enhances the printing quality for text and images […] while reduc[ing] the cost to businesses by reducing printing costs per page”.
